Granville County Public Schools holds 2025 winter graduation; no formal board business conducted

Granville County Public Schools held a winter graduation ceremony recognizing students and district leaders. The transcript records ceremonial remarks, introductions, and diploma presentations; no substantive policy discussion or formal governing actions occurred.

Granville County Public Schools held a winter graduation ceremony in 2025 that included the posting of colors, the Pledge of Allegiance, remarks from School Board Chair Dr. Heather Lindsey and district leaders, musical selections, and presentation of diplomas to graduates from multiple high schools and academies. The transcript records ceremonial acknowledgments of district staff, administrators and elected officials and a long list of individual graduates called to receive diplomas.

The meeting text contains no substantive policy discussion, motions, votes, or administrative decisions. Speakers offered congratulatory and motivational remarks; the transcript does not record agendas, budget items, ordinances, contracts, or directives to staff. Because the record is ceremonial, there were no formal actions to summarize or outcomes to report.
